MS Relapsing/Remitting Type
Previous Entry :: Next Entry

Read/Post Comments (8)

--exhausted, weak (like having been in bathtub far too long)
--pain in joints/back/sciatic
--extreme sensitivity to heat
--muscle spasms around ribs and waist
--emotional lability
--short term memory (what am I writing about...I forget)

Every task is a huge expenditure of energy, followed by collapse. An hour's nap required before being ready for another task. And that's how you make it through the next few days. If it gets worse, just take to your bed and drink Emergen-C and wait it out.
